The character 虞 (yú) is a phono-semantic compound, with 虍 (hū, "tiger") as the semantic component and 吳 (wú) as the phonetic. Its earliest meanings involved mythological creatures, forestry officials, and hunting preserves in ancient times. Later, it came to denote anticipation, foresight, anxiety, and deceit, often implying a state of readiness for unexpected events or treachery. In classical texts, it can express worry or the act of laying a trap, and it also serves as the name of an ancient state. The character thus evolved from concrete associations with tigers and hunting to abstract notions of mental calculation and apprehension.
